Pimp C Found Dead In Hollywood Hotel
Wednesday, December 5, 2007 By: Kenny Rodriguez
Pimp C, born Chad Butler, was found dead early Tuesday morning in a West Hollywood hotel room, as early reports say he passed away from natural causes.
Paramedics and officers responded to a 911 call placed from the Mondrian Hotel on Sunset Boulevard at about 9:30 a.m.
Upon arrival, they found Butler fully-clothed lying on a bed in a hotel room.
According to a spokesman for the county coroner, it appears Butler died of natural causes. No drugs or paraphernalia were found in the room, and it didn’t appear as if anyone had been in the vicinity when he died.
A full autopsy will be performed, and results are expected to be ready in six-to-eight weeks.
“We mourn the unexpected loss of Chad,” Jive Records president and CEO Barry Weiss said.
“He was truly a thoughtful and kindhearted person. He will be remembered for his talent and profound influence as a pioneer in bringing southern rap to the forefront.
“He will be missed, and our prayers remain with his family and Bun B. I’ve known Chad since he was 18 and we loved him dearly, and he was a cherished member of the Jive family.”
By Tuesday afternoon, the rapper’s MySpace page featured the headline: “C The Pimp Is FREE At Last,” a slogan which was popularized while Butler was incarcerated for three years due to gun charges in 2002.
Butler, who was one-half of the Texas rap duo UGK, was 33 years old.
He is survived by a wife and three children.
